dev@grizzly.java.net

gws issue

From: <rama.rama_at_tiscali.it>
Date: Sun, 26 Apr 2009 15:45:54 +0200 (CEST)

Hello,

i am having some issue with gws vers 1.9.14, on linux (seems
that on win i haven't that issue)
i am using 1.6.0 b13.

let me give to
you more information and explain what's up.


after a while, without
any apparent error on logging, gws became very slow.

after a bit of
profiling i have get some of this line

12:08.653 30 s Blocked 428
java.lang.Object GrizzlySelectorRunner-TCP [Grizzly] http5480-
WorkerThread(39) [Grizzly]
12:05.843 33 s Blocked 427 java.lang.Object
GrizzlySelectorRunner-TCP [Grizzly] http5480-WorkerThread(24) [Grizzly]


that say that
GrizzlySelectorRunner-TCP [Grizzly] THREAD
WorkerThread
(24) [Grizzly] TCP

also some other like
12:50.186 84 s Blocked 116
java.util.HashSet http5480-WorkerThread(44) [Grizzly]
GrizzlySelectorRunner-TCP [Grizzly]

the problem isn't that there are
some lock, but that the lock last for 84Seconds!!

i'll also add a
stacktrace (sorry, it's very big, i add a zip, i have try to put 6
reader, many worker threads, to do a work around, but without successs)


if someone can give to me some idea, i'll really appreciate